Ogun Police  Enhances Security at Sagamu Interchange, Assures Citizens of Safety

The Ogun State Police Command has intensified security measures at the four intersections of the Sagamu Interchange to ensure the safety of residents and commuters.

 

This follows recent concerns over security in the area, including reports circulating on social media about an incident on the 21st of March, 2025.

 

While no such incident was formally reported at any police station, the Commissioner of Police, CP Lanre Ogunlowo, PhD, has proactively led efforts to reinforce security at the Sagamu interchange.

 

As part of these measures, personnel from the Quick Response Squad, OP Mesa, and Mobile Police Squadrons 71 have been strategically stationed at key locations, including under the bridge, at the roundabouts, and along the inward and outward routes of the four intersections.

 

A two-hour assement of the area conducted by the Commissioner of Police, revealed  illegal trading activities and presence of touts. Earlier in the day, a criminal hideout was discovered in surrounding bush at the interchange and three suspects were arrested.

 

Thereafter, an immediate disbandment of illegal trading activities under the interchange bridge was carried out

 

 

To further enhance security at the interchange, the Commissioner of Police has engaged members of the transport Union to redirect traffic towards well-lit and secure areas.

 

While Ogun State remains relatively peaceful, the police command urges citizens to remain vigilant and avoid falling victim to criminal activities.

 

As a precautionary measure, commuters are advised to plan their travels early to minimise security risks.

 

With increased security presence, collaborative efforts of sister security agencies, and continued support of his excellency  the governor of Ogun State, citizens are assured of the safety of our highways.
